For this years band activities they competed in the Madison Trojan Day Street Marching Competition and did very well. They gave a well prepared and an enjoyable Christmas Concert for the public. In the spring, they worked hard getting ready for the contest in Madison. The arrangements they took were Chorale Prelude ' 'Sleepers Wake'1 by Bach and Dedicatory Overture by Clifton Williams. They received a second rating. After contests and concerts were over they began thinking about marching again. This spring they planned a trip to Rapid City where they will compete in the Street Marching Competition.
